The Impact of Physical Activity on Blood Sugar Levels
Exercise is another essential component of maintaining healthy blood sugar ranges. Regular physical activity improves insulin sensitivity, allowing cells to more effectively absorb glucose from the bloodstream. Even moderate-intensity exercise like brisk walking or cycling can significantly lower fasting glucose levels and improve overall glycemic control. According to a meta-analysis published in Diabetes Care, regular aerobic exercise reduced HbA1c by 0.5-1% compared to sedentary controls.
The Link Between Stress and Blood Sugar Fluctuations
Stress is another often-overlooked factor that can significantly impact blood sugar levels. When we're under stress, our body's fight-or-flight response triggers the release of cortisol, a hormone that raises glucose levels in the bloodstream. Chronic stress can lead to insulin resistance and exacerbate existing diabetes conditions. Engaging in relaxation techniques like deep breathing, yoga, or meditation can help mitigate this effect.

Finally, getting adequate sleep is essential for maintaining healthy blood sugar ranges. Research has consistently shown that poor sleep quality leads to impaired glucose regulation, insulin resistance, and an increased risk of developing type 2 diabetes. The Consequences of Neglecting Blood Sugar Management
Ignoring blood sugar management can have serious consequences on our health. High or low blood glucose levels can lead to symptoms ranging from mild (fatigue, headaches) to severe (coma, seizures). Moreover, maintaining poor blood sugar control increases the risk of developing chronic conditions like cardiovascular disease and kidney damage.

Blood sugar tested on an empty stomach, also called fasting blood glucose, can help determine whether you are healthy or have a medical condition like Type 2 diabetes. Different medical conditions can cause your fasting blood sugar to be higher or lower than normal, and certain medications can also affect your blood sugar levels. Too High A fasting blood glucose score of 100 to 125 milligrams per deciliter often means you have a condition called pre-diabetes, and if your blood sugar level is above 126 milligrams per deciliter it usually means you have diabetes. Some signs of high blood sugar levels including increased thirst and frequent urination. Too Low Should your test results show a fasting blood sugar level under 70 milligrams per deciliter, you may an underactive thyroid or a pituitary problem called hypopituitarism. Diabetics may get this type of result if they've taken too much diabetes medication or insulin. Low blood sugar levels can cause symptoms including fatigue, confusion, fast heartbeat, lightheadedness, shakiness and irritability.
